"ыйыт" meaning in Yakut

See ыйыт in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Verb

Forms: ıyıt [romanization]
Etymology: Causative of ый (ıy, “to indicate”), from Proto-Turkic *āy- (“to say, to tell”), compare Kyrgyz айтуу (aytuu), Turkish ayıtmak, Chuvash ыйт (yjt).
